What to Know About USPS in North Patchogue, New York

North Patchogue, located in Suffolk County, New York, has a population of approximately 6,870 residents. The area is characterized by a mix of suburban communities and commercial developments, contributing to a moderate population density. This suburban layout allows for efficient delivery routes; however, local traffic patterns can affect delivery times, especially during peak hours. North Patchogue is well-connected through major roads like Route 112 and is in proximity to the Long Island Expressway, facilitating the movement of USPS delivery vehicles.

The geography of North Patchogue features a combination of residential neighborhoods and natural landscapes, which can impact weather conditions and, consequently, delivery logistics. Suffolk County experiences a temperate climate, with cold winters and warm summers; severe snowstorms or heavy rain can occasionally disrupt service. However, USPS maintains a commitment to timely deliveries, often employing various methods to adapt to weather conditions. With a solid infrastructure in place, including postal service facilities nearby, residents typically experience reliable delivery times, although external factors like local events and weather can occasionally influence schedules.

We Make Your USPS Delivery CO2 positive

The receipt of a shipment causes about 500g CO2. A tree can bind about one ton of CO2 in a lifetime. To be climate neutral this would be 1 tree for 2000 sendings. But CO2 neutral is not enough! That's why we plant a tree at least every 1000 USPS shipments and thus make the receipt of USPS parcels climate positive for all users.
